Excuse me for posting here as it is likely a packaging problem, yet I thought I could get some hints here before proceeding with a Debian bug report.

Trying to use the new NumPy support, I came up with the following partial hello world code which compiles, links but fails with an undefined symbol error at runtime:

*hello.cpp*:
```C++
#include

void init()
{
Py_Initialize();
boost::python::numpy::initialize();
}

BOOST_PYTHON_MODULE(hello)
{
}
```

*CMakeLists.txt*:
```CMake
project(hello CXX)
cmake_minimum_required(VERSION 3.7)

add_library(hello SHARED hello.cpp)
set_target_properties(hello PROPERTIES SUFFIX ".so") # e.g. Mac defaults to .dylib which is not looked for by Python

# informing the Python bindings where to find Python
find_package(PythonInterp REQUIRED)
find_package(PythonLibs ${PYTHON_VERSION_STRING} EXACT REQUIRED)
target_include_directories(hello PUBLIC ${PYTHON_INCLUDE_DIRS})
target_link_libraries(hello ${PYTHON_LIBRARIES})

# informing the Python bindings where to find Boost.Python
# NumPy support was introduced in 1.63
find_package(Boost 1.63 COMPONENTS python-py${PYTHON_VERSION_MAJOR}${PYTHON_VERSION_MINOR} QUIET REQUIRED)
target_link_libraries(hello ${Boost_LIBRARIES})
target_include_directories(hello PUBLIC ${Boost_INCLUDE_DIRS})
```

Here's what happens on a all-standard Ubuntu zesty installation with the Debian/Ubuntu 1.63 packages:

```
$ mkdir build
$ cd build/
$ cmake ..
-- The CXX compiler identification is GNU 4.9.2
-- Check for working CXX compiler: /usr/bin/c++
-- Check for working CXX compiler: /usr/bin/c++ -- works
-- Detecting CXX compiler ABI info
-- Detecting CXX compiler ABI info - done
-- Detecting CXX compile features
-- Detecting CXX compile features - done
-- Found PythonInterp: /usr/bin/python (found version "2.7.13")
-- Found PythonLibs: /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libpython2.7.so (found suitable exact version "2.7.13")
CMake Warning at /usr/share/cmake-3.7/Modules/FindBoost.cmake:1534 (message):
No header defined for python-py27; skipping header check
Call Stack (most recent call first):
CMakeLists.txt:16 (find_package)

-- Configuring done
-- Generating done
-- Build files have been written to: /home/vagrant/temp/build
$ make
Scanning dependencies of target hello
[ 50%] Building CXX object CMakeFiles/hello.dir/hello.cpp.o
[100%] Linking CXX shared library libhello.so
[100%] Built target hello
$ python
Python 2.7.13 (default, Jan 19 2017, 14:48:08)
[GCC 6.3.0 20170118] on linux2
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> import libhello
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"", line 1, in
ImportError: ./libhello.so: undefined symbol: _ZN5boost6python5numpy10initializeEb
>>>
```

Also:
```
$ ldd libhello.so
linux-vdso.so.1 => (0x00007ffd301d5000)
libpython2.7.so.1.0 => /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libpython2.7.so.1.0 (0x00007f2c04b3b000)
libboost_python-py27.so.1.63.0 => /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py27.so.1.63.0 (0x00007f2c048f2000)
libc.so.6 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libc.so.6 (0x00007f2c0452b000)
libpthread.so.0 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libpthread.so.0 (0x00007f2c0430d000)
libz.so.1 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libz.so.1 (0x00007f2c040f2000)
libdl.so.2 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libdl.so.2 (0x00007f2c03eec000)
libutil.so.1 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libutil.so.1 (0x00007f2c03ce9000)
libm.so.6 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libm.so.6 (0x00007f2c039e0000)
libstdc++.so.6 => /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libstdc++.so.6 (0x00007f2c03658000)
libgcc_s.so.1 => /l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gcc_s.so.1 (0x00007f2c03441000)
/lib64/ld-linux-x86-64.so.2 (0x00007f2c052de000)
```

```
$ ls -1 /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python*
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python.a
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py27.a
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py27.so
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py27.so.1.63.0
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py35.a
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py35.so
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python-py35.so.1.63.0
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python.so
```

```
$ nm /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libboost_python*.a | grep numpy | wc -l
0
```

Thanks in advance for any hints
